Construction Project Manager $70,000 - $90,000 per year!
Our Reconstruction Project Manager role goes far beyond managing projects it's project leadership with purpose. You will successfully lead and manage all reconstruction projects to completion, on time and on budget.
What You'll Do
- Be the first reconstruction professional on-site after fires, floods, and other disasters.
- Assess property damage and determine reconstruction needs quickly and accurately.
- Build immediate trust with homeowners, commercial clients, and insurance partners.
- Lead property owners through the reconstruction process with clarity, urgency, and care.
- Manage budgets, schedules, tradesmen, and job site performance from start to finish.
- Oversee job plans, timelines, compliance, documentation, and project flow with Project Coordinators.
- Coordinate subcontractors and in-house trades to ensure quality workmanship.
- Maintain alignment with TPA and insurance guidelines.
- Be available during off-hours—because disasters don't follow a 9–5 schedule.

Working Conditions & Physical Requirements
- Ability to work in indoor and outdoor environments in all weather conditions.
- Frequent use of PPE; ability to stand, walk, bend, squat, climb stairs, and lift up to 50 lbs.
- Job sites may include damaged structures, debris, or hazards typical of post-disaster environments.
